ZIP 71045 and ZIP 71048 are ZIP Code areas in Louisiana.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 71045 has the higher population (510 vs 114 in ZIP 71048). ZIP 71048 has the higher median household income ($88,214 vs $70,855 in ZIP 71045). ZIP 71045 has the higher median home value ($85,600 vs $55,200 in ZIP 71048).
Population, income & housing
| ZIP 71045 | ZIP 71048 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 510 | 114 |
| Median age | 54.5 yrs | 77.1 yrs |
| Median household income | $70,855 | $88,214 |
| Median home value | $85,600 | $55,200 |
| Median gross rent | $389 | — |
| Housing units | 475 | 108 |
| Homeownership rate | 67.8% | 82.5%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 11.1% | 4.5% |
| Unemployment rate | 5.6% | 8.1% |
